In part four of our conversation with Alfredo Andere, co-founder of LatchBio, we explore how the company evolved from a simple workflow orchestrator into a comprehensive platform serving biopharma companies and solution providers. Alfredo shares his approach to enterprise sales, emphasizing the importance of speed, focus, and building strong relationships with customers. He also delves into his philosophy on fundraising and the pivotal role of iterative development in creating impactful biotech solutions.

Alfredo reflects on the challenges and rewards of working in niche markets, explaining why deep commitment and loyalty to specific problems are essential for long-term success. Key topics covered:
  • Iterative product development: Expanding LatchBio’s platform from workflows to data storage and analysis
  • Biopharma vs. solution providers: How LatchBio serves these distinct customer groups
  • Enterprise sales best practices: Qualifying leads and acting as a consultant to customer problems
  • Fundraising strategies: Why early-stage rounds focus on vision and team, while later rounds prioritize traction
  • The power of focus: Avoiding the trap of optionality and scaling only when ready
